Mr. Speaker, May marks Military Appreciation Month, a special time to recognize the tremendous support and encouragement families offer their servicemembers. As the son of a Flying Tiger who served in India and China, and as the grateful father of four sons who have all served overseas, and as a 31-year veteran of the Army Reserve and Guard, I know firsthand the commitment of our troops, veterans, and military families. Last week, I was honored to join Senator Roy Blunt, Senator Kirsten Gillibrand, and Congresswoman Susan Davis to introduce commonsense, bipartisan legislation, the Military Families Stability Act, which provides for greater flexibility by allowing military families a 6- month option of moving to the start of their next assignment. The happiness and success of our military families is critical to overall troop readiness and retention. I am confident this legislation will greatly benefit families around the country.
